Ceigall India edges higher after bagging constrution contracts worth Rs 1,042 crore (09-08-2024)
Ceigall India gained 1.46% to Rs 391.70 after the company announced that it has secured orders for development of Kanpur Central Bus Terminal and Bhuvaneshwar Metro Project Phase-I aggregating to Rs 1,042 crore.

JSW Steel’s consolidated crude steel production at 22.15 lakh tonnes in July’24 (09-08-2024)
JSW Steel said that its consolidated crude steel production for the month of July 2024 was at 22.15 lakh tonnes, which is higher by 9% as compared with the same period last year.
SAIL slides after Q1 PAT slips 93% YoY to Rs 11 cr (09-08-2024)
Steel Authority of India (SAIL) declined 1.56% to Rs 135.35 after the company’s standalone net profit dropped 92.87% to Rs 10.68 crore in Q1 FY25 from Rs 149.83 crore in Q1 FY24.
